Output 31f112c995c83320ab1abcd799a81b4fec274ed0e7c80e883609792dc01abc0e:0

value
1218796
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f29433e4c88df3d87dce7507fc9ac9d90de24836 OP_EQUAL
address
3PoezGhcU2uNEz4YnnoJmK5ckQ2jLNgG6W
transaction
31f112c995c83320ab1abcd799a81b4fec274ed0e7c80e883609792dc01abc0e
spent
true